When selecting lighting for parking garages, understanding requirements and standards is essential. Illuminance levels should meet safety and visibility needs. The standard for parking garages typically requires at least 2-5 foot-candles on the parking surface. This helps drivers navigate safely and reduces accidents. Uniform lighting distribution minimizes shadows and dark spots, which can be areas of concern.

Selecting appropriate lighting for parking garages is crucial for safety and efficiency. Different lighting technologies present unique advantages and challenges. LED lights have gained popularity due to their energy efficiency and longevity. According to the U.S. Department of Energy, LED lights consume 75% less energy than traditional incandescent options. This not only reduces operational costs but also lowers the carbon footprint.
Fluorescent lights offer good brightness but have a shorter lifespan than LEDs. They can be effective in low-traffic areas, providing decent illumination for basic needs. However, their performance can diminish over time, which raises maintenance concerns. Reports indicate that with average usage, fluorescent bulbs may need replacement every 12 months.
High-Pressure Sodium (HPS) lights produce a yellowish glow and are often used in outdoor settings. Their high luminosity can deter crime but is not ideal for distinguishing colors. This limitation can confuse drivers and pedestrians. Studies show that while HPS lights are cheaper upfront, they can lead to higher energy costs in the long run due to their inefficiency. Reflecting on these aspects can help decision-makers weigh their options effectively.
In parking garages, proper lighting is essential for safety and visibility. According to the Illuminating Engineering Society (IES), a minimum illumination level of 2 foot-candles is recommended for parking areas. This standard guides facilities to ensure that drivers and pedestrians can see clearly, reducing the risk of accidents.
Adequate lighting helps deter crime. Studies show that well-lit areas experience up to 40% fewer criminal incidents. Shadows can create feelings of unease and unsafe environments. A well-designed lighting plan can eliminate dark spots. This enhances not just visual clarity but also a sense of security.
Here are some tips for choosing effective lighting:
- Use LED lights for their longevity and efficiency.
- Consider motion sensors to save energy during low traffic times.
- Incorporate ambient lighting in high-traffic areas.
While these methods can greatly improve visibility, challenges remain. Not all fixtures provide even illumination. Over time, dust and grime can reduce light output. Regular maintenance checks are crucial to ensure consistent light levels. Addressing these factors can significantly enhance safety and visibility in parking garages.

Selecting the right lighting for parking garages requires careful consideration of maintenance and durability. Proper lighting not only enhances safety but also minimizes long-term costs. According to the Illuminating Engineering Society (IES), well-maintained lighting can reduce energy consumption by up to 30%. This is significant for large facilities where energy costs add up quickly.
LED fixtures are often recommended due to their longevity and lower maintenance needs. They can last up to 50,000 hours, significantly decreasing the frequency of replacements. Regular inspections are critical. Dust and dirt can accumulate, diminishing brightness and efficiency. Ensure fixtures are clean, and check for any signs of wear periodically.
Tips: Implement a cleaning schedule every few months. Schedule maintenance during off-peak hours to minimize disruption. Consider motion sensors to reduce energy use during low-traffic periods. Choosing durable materials can also enhance longevity; opt for fixtures designed to withstand harsh conditions.
Durability matters. Even with high-quality products, factors like humidity and temperature fluctuations can impact performance. Regularly evaluate the lighting's effectiveness; if shadows or dark spots develop, it may signify a need for upgrades. Balancing initial investment with long-term benefits is essential for a successful lighting strategy.
